  • What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?

    Penny, being a Beagle mix, usually fits well in a family environment with access to a securely fenced yard. She can adapt to smaller homes as long as she gets regular walks and playtime.

  • How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?

    As a Beagle mix, Penny benefits from daily outdoor activity—ideally, she’d get time in a yard or regular walks to satisfy her active nose and curious nature.

  •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?

    Beagle mixes like Penny are known for their gentle and playful nature, making them very suitable for homes with children.
